In Ellens Math class, there are 2 boys for every 3 girls. if there are 21 girls in the class, how many boys are in the classroom.

Answer:

14 boys

Step-by-step explanation:

Given,

There are 3 girls for every 2 boys

So,

For every 1 girl

[tex] = \frac{2}{3} \: boys [/tex]

Therefore,

For every 21 girls,

[tex] = \frac{2}{3} \times 21 \: boys[/tex]

= 14 boys (Ans)
